American English Definition British English Definition
noun:  A kind of coarse woollen cloth or stuff with a shaggy or tufted (friezed) nap on one side.
verb:  (transitive) To make a nap on (cloth); to friz.
noun:  (architecture) That part of the entablature of an order which is between the architrave and cornice. It is a flat member or face, either uniform or broken by triglyphs, and often enriched with figures and other ornaments of sculpture.
noun:  Any sculptured or richly ornamented band in a building or, by extension, in rich pieces of furniture.
noun:  A banner with a series of pictures.
verb:  (transitive, architecture) To put a frieze on.
